The Ministry of Corporate Affairs has issued a fresh notice to fintech unicorn BharatPe seeking details about its operations and the proceedings against its co-founder Ashneer Grover.
The ministry is also inquiring about the findings in a status report filed by the Delhi Police's Economic Offences Wing over alleged financial irregularities at the company.
In response to this, Ashneer Grover, in a post on X, said that he has nothing to do with the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A) notice against the fintech startup.
"I am happy MCA is looking into bharatpe india company matters. I’ve moved NCLT against the Company. I don’t have the MCA notice - it’s served to Company - not me - I am sure it’s got nothing to do with me," Grover said in a post on X.
